pgadmin helm

pgadmin is a popular administration tool for PostgreSQL. It is a web application that can be run in Kubernetes.

Install

Install with:

helm repo add bjw-s oci://ghcr.io/bjw-s/helm/
helm install pgadmin bjw-s/app-template -f values.yaml

Examples

See examples from other people.

Top Repositories (1 out of 16)

NameRepoStarsVersionTimestamp
pgadminbrettinternet/homeops2313.5.17 months ago

Values

See the most popular values for this chart:

KeyTypes
boolean
string
string
string
string
string
string
string
string
string
persistence.config.path (1)
/volume1/network-storage/pgadmin-talos
string
string
string
string
string
string
string
boolean
persistence.local-config.name (3)
pgadmin-local-config-configmap
string
string
boolean
string
boolean
string
string
string
string
string
boolean
persistence.oauth.name (2)
pgadmin-secret-auth
string
string
string
string
string
string
controllers.pgadmin.containers.app.image.tag (10)
9.3@sha256:bd71932cb1ef94719e783f0eed42c227bc67877a7c7e076c7092738711e5f4d4
string
string
string
string
string
string
string
number
string
string
string
string
string
string
string
number
string
string
boolean
boolean
number
string
number
number
number
number
boolean
boolean
number
string
number
number
number
number
string
number
string
number
number
controllers.pgadmin.initContainers.volume-permissions.command[] (1)
- /bin/chown
- -R
- "5050:5050"
- /var/lib/pgadmin
string
string
controllers.pgadmin.initContainers.volume-permissions.image.tag (1)
9.2@sha256:52cb72a9e3da275324ca0b9bb3891021366d501aad375db34584a7bca8ce02ff
string
number
number
string
string
string
controllers.main.containers.main.image.tag (3)
9.3@sha256:bd71932cb1ef94719e783f0eed42c227bc67877a7c7e076c7092738711e5f4d4
string, number
string
string
string
string
string
string
number
string
number
number
string
string
number
number
string
string
boolean
ingress.app.hosts[].host (9)
pgadmin.${SECRET_DOMAIN}
string
string
string
string
ingress.app.tls[].hosts[] (6)
- pgadmin.${SECRET_DOMAIN}
string
string
string
string
string
string
ingress.app.annotations."gethomepage.dev/description" (3)
Web-based administration for PostgreSQL
string
ingress.app.annotations."nginx.ingress.kubernetes.io/auth-signin" (2)
https://auth.${SECRET_DOMAIN}/oauth2/auth/oauth2/start?rd=$scheme://$host$request_uri
string
ingress.app.annotations."nginx.ingress.kubernetes.io/auth-url" (2)
http://oauth2-proxy.security.svc.cluster.local:4180/oauth2/auth
string
string
string
string
string
string
ingress.app.annotations."nginx.ingress.kubernetes.io/auth-snippet" (1)
proxy_set_header X-Forwarded-Method $request_method;
string
string
string
string
boolean
ingress.main.hosts[].host (6)
pgadmin.${SECRET_DOMAIN}
string
string
string
string
string
string
ingress.main.tls[].hosts[] (5)
- pgadmin.${SECRET_DOMAIN}
string
ingress.main.tls[].secretName (1)
pgadmin-production-tls
string
string
string
string
string
string
string
string
string
string
string
string
string
number
string
number
number
string, number
string
string, number
string, number
string
number
string
image.repository (3)
dpage/pgadmin4
string
string
string
string
string
string
string
string
env.PGADMIN_DEFAULT_PASSWORD (1)
${POSTGRES_ADMIN_PASSWORD}
string
initContainers.volume-permissions.command[] (1)
- /bin/chown
- -R
- "5050:5050"
- /var/lib/pgadmin
string
string
number
string
string